Bentley SUV will create a new niche
Tue, 17 Sep 2013The Bentley SUV (EXP 9 F pictured) will create a new market sector. We all saw the Bentley SUV when it arrive two years ago at the Geneva Motor show, and the general consensus was along the lines of ‘What a truck’. But Bentley have taken that reaction on board and are busy redesigning the looks of their SUV (well, the exterior anyway – the interior was lovely) to give it a more appealing look, one probably more biased towards an SUV version of the Continental Series rather than the Mulsanne.
Video: Pininfarina Sergio design process revealed
Fri, 08 Mar 2013Pininfarina has released a short video about the conception and development of its Sergio concept. The video traces the concept's processes from original sketches up to the final model and highlights how it was inspired by Sergio Pininfarina's belief that to preserve its heritage it must make it part of its future. Car Design News was given the exclusive first sight of the Sergio, named in honor of the great man, ahead of its world debut earlier this week in Geneva.
